How to fill out national treasury contract management

How to fill out national treasury contract management:
01
Begin by gathering all necessary documents and information related to the contract, such as the contract itself, vendor information, and any supporting documentation.
02
Review the contract terms and conditions thoroughly to ensure a complete understanding of the obligations and requirements outlined. Take note of any specific instructions or deadlines mentioned.
03
Complete all sections of the contract as accurately and comprehensively as possible. Provide the requested information, such as the names of parties involved, contract duration, payment terms, and any relevant schedules or attachments.
04
Pay close attention to the financial aspects of the contract. Ensure that budget allocations, payment milestones, and any applicable pricing or discounts are filled out correctly. If necessary, consult with relevant financial personnel or departments for accurate information.
05
Remember to verify the legitimacy and authority of the signing parties. Confirm that the individuals signing the contract have the necessary authorization and legal capacity to do so.
06
Seek legal advice if there are any uncertainties or complexities within the contract. This can help ensure compliance with local laws and regulations, minimize risks, and protect the interests of all parties involved.
Who needs national treasury contract management?
01
Government agencies and institutions: National treasury contract management is crucial for government entities as they often enter into contracts with vendors, suppliers, and service providers. Effective contract management helps ensure transparency, accountability, and compliance with financial regulations.
02
Private companies and organizations: Companies that work closely with government entities or participate in public procurement processes may also require national treasury contract management. This helps them navigate the intricacies of government contracting, manage risks, and maintain contractual obligations effectively.
03
Contract managers and procurement professionals: Individuals responsible for managing contracts within organizations, including procurement professionals and contract managers, need national treasury contract management knowledge and skills. It enables them to effectively draft, negotiate, and manage contracts while ensuring compliance and mitigating risks.
04
Legal and financial professionals: Lawyers specializing in contract law and financial experts who deal with public procurement often require knowledge of national treasury contract management. They provide guidance, ensure legal compliance, and advise on financial aspects of the contracts for government agencies and private organizations.
Overall, national treasury contract management is essential for both public and private entities involved in government contracting, enabling effective governance, financial management, and legal compliance.
